Gemstone Guide

Amethyst

The zodiac stone for Pisces and birthstone for February, Amethyst is mined in several countries including Brazil, Kenya, Madagascar and the USA. The purple gemstone is also said to promote calm and serenity and is attributed with courage and peace.

Onyx

The zodiac stone for Leo and the birthstone for February, Onyx is mined in Brazil, India, California and Uruguay. Though traditionally black in colour, there are varieties of sardonyx which have bands of white running through them. Onyx is considered to be a good protective stone which relieves stress and aids sleep.

Citrine

Associated with the month of November and the zodiac stone for Virgo, today, the majority of citrine is mined in Brazil, though areas of Spain, France and Scotland have previously produced the gemstone. Citrine is said to attract success and prosperity, whilst promoting creativity and cheerfulness for the wearer.

LApis Lazuli

The zodiac stone for Libra and the birthstone for December, Lapis Lazuli has traditionally been mined in Afghanistan, though deposits also occur in Canada, Chile and Mongolia. Lapis Lazuli is believed to be the stone of truth and friendship, and was one of the first gemstones to be worn as jewellery.

Amazonite

The birthstone for December and zodiac stone of Virgo, Amazonite is mined in Namibia, Colorado and Zimbabwe. Though named after the Brazilian river, no deposits have actually been found in that particular area of Brazil. Amazonite is said to bring prosperity, calm emotions and make married life happier.

Agate

Agate is the zodiac stone for Gemini and the birthstone of September, the main source of Agate is the western US states of Montana and Idaho, though mines also occur in Australia, Brazil and Madagascar. An emotional healer, Agate is also said to encourage memory, concentration and self-confidence. Agate comes in a range of colour; Fire Agate is an iridescent red.

LAbradorite

The zodiac stone for Sagittarius, Labradorite was first mined in the region of Canada bearing the same name, and can now be located in Mexico, China and Scandinavia. Labradorite is said to promote wisdom and patience and improve self-esteem.

Moonstone

The birthstone for the month of June, moonstone is not associated with any specific zodiac, and is mined in several countries including Sri Lanka, Norway, Australia and Tanzania. Moonstone is considered to bring good fortune to the wearer, and is said to protect women and children particularly during pregnancy and childbirth.

Smoky Quartz

The zodiac stone for Capricorn, smoky quartz is mined in Brazil, Japan, Australia and previously Scotland. It is believed to be a calm and comforting stone which improves intuition and minimises negative emotions.

Tiger’s Eye

The zodiac stone for Gemini, Tiger’s Eye is mined mainly in South Africa but is also found in Burma and California. A form of quartz, Tiger’s Eye is said to encourage confidence and courage, and bring good luck.

Freshwater Pearl

The zodiac stone of Cancer and the modern June birthstone, freshwater pearls are commonly grown in China and Australia, and are available in numerous colours and varieties. Pearls signify strength and sincerity, and traditionally used by brides due to their connotations with love and marital bliss.

Pyrite

Pyrite is not associated with any zodiac sign or birthstone and mining occurs throughout the world in countries including Mexico, Bolivia and South Africa. Pyrite is believed to improve memory, intelligence and analytical ability.

Hematite

Associated with the zodiac sign of Aries, hematite is mined in Switzerland, Italy and the area of Minas Gerais in Brazil. Traditionally perceived as a grounding stone, hematite is believed to increase optimism and reduce stress.

Cornelian/Carnelian

The zodiac stone for Virgo, Carnelian is mined in various countries including Japan, Brazil and Uruguay. Known for its vibrant colour, it is also said to encourage confidence and a drive to succeed.

Rock Crystal

Rock crystal is used as an alternative birthstone to the diamond for the month of April. This colourless variety of quartz is mined internationally in countries including the UK, Switzerland and Madagascar. Rock crystal is considered to help with all conditions and helps focus the mind.

Malachite

Malachite is the birthstone for those born in the month of July and is associated with the zodiac signs of Pisces, Capricorn and Scorpio. This striking gem stone can be found in numerous countries including Namibia, Siberia, Mexico and France, and is said to promote a good night’s sleep and creativity.
